How they compare
Iceland currently reports 183.93 billion current US$ against 182.55 billion current US$ in Estonia, a difference of 1.38 billion current US$.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Iceland ahead.
Estonia ranks 85th and Iceland ranks 84th of 150 countries.
Iceland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Estonia | Iceland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 31.27 billion current US$ | 75.36 billion current US$ | 44.09 billion current US$ | Iceland |
| 2000s | 80.59 billion current US$ | 126.37 billion current US$ | 45.78 billion current US$ | Iceland |
| 2010s | 142.95 billion current US$ | 149.99 billion current US$ | 7.04 billion current US$ | Iceland |
| 2020s | 182.55 billion current US$ | 183.93 billion current US$ | 1.38 billion current US$ | Iceland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
